A desirable New Zealand WWI 15ct gold patriotic medallion to Alfred Leaman a farmhand from South Canterbury. 14.6gms. (see previous lot),

Estimate $2,000 - $2,400

Realised: $2,100 plus premium

Lot Details

the Maltese cross engraved recto with monogram 'AL' and with pairs of fern leaves to each of the arms. Engraved verso: 'NZ Expeditionary Force, Presented To A. Leaman by his Omihi Friends, 1914' (Omihi, Hurunui District, Sth Canterbury). Alfred Walter Herman Leaman, (26 July 1888 - 26 Nov 1986), Tpr. Canty. Mtd. Rifles. WWI 7/358 NZEF, 2/Lieut., active service in Egypt and at Gallipolli. WWII 3/17/1690. See previous lot.
